"Journals of Australian Explorations" offers a firsthand account of the intrepid journeys into the heart of the Australian continent by A C and F T Gregory. These meticulously kept journals document their expeditions, chronicling the challenges and triumphs of discovery in a vast and largely unknown land. A vital resource for anyone interested in the history of Australia, this book provides invaluable insight into the exploration and mapping of the continent. Through detailed observations and engaging prose, the Gregory brothers capture the spirit of adventure and the importance of their geographical surveys.
